Transaction 3f164214ceb4376fc11e984024ec8a4b616c563ef64aa37552c34efabd865462

2 Input
2 Outputs
  • 3f164214ceb4376fc11e984024ec8a4b616c563ef64aa37552c34efabd865462:0
  • value  5342775
    address  17Dsm9XnpgxYRBSgawN85Hr6aL8RNnpAik
  • 3f164214ceb4376fc11e984024ec8a4b616c563ef64aa37552c34efabd865462:1
  • value  23510000
    address  1Kp9prVAPfLPfRTfMfhrTvuLUr6tq8mLWL